Advanced encryption protocols

  1. AES-256 encryption provides bank-level security through complex mathematical algorithms, cryptographic keys, and data scrambling techniques that render intercepted information unreadable without proper decryption keys.
  2. SSL certificates create secure communication tunnels between player devices, gaming servers, and payment processors through encrypted data transmission, identity verification, and secure handshake protocols that prevent eavesdropping, data interception, and unauthorised access during information exchange.
  3. End-to-end encryption ensures complete data protection from initial transmission through the final destination, preventing intermediate access, manipulation, or interception throughout communication pathways.

Financial transaction protection

  1. Payment processing security involves tokenisation, secure payment gateways, encrypted financial data, and fraud detection systems that protect monetary transactions, banking information, and credit card details from theft, manipulation, and unauthorised access. These systems replace sensitive financial data with secure tokens, rendering stolen information useless.
  2. Real-time fraud monitoring analyses transaction patterns, spending behaviours, unusual activities, and suspicious transactions through advanced algorithms, machine learning, and behavioural analysis that detect potential fraud, identity theft, and unauthorised account access immediately upon occurrence.
  3. PCI DSS compliance ensures payment card industry standards, secure payment processing, data protection requirements, regulatory adherence through certified security measures, regular audits, and compliance verification that protects cardholder information, financial transactions, and banking relationships.
